FIH - 4th World Youth Hockey Promoters Festival in Victoria
24 Apr 2008 00:00
 
The aim of the World Youth Hockey Promoters Festival is to create hockey development awareness among young people who are our future coaches, managers, umpires, technical officials or administrators to promote hockey as a global sport, played around the world and last but not least to give Youth a Voice and therefore retain them longer.

The participants who are in the age group 15-21 will come from all over the world -  Argentina, Bangladesh, Barbados, Canada, Croatia, England, Germany, Hong Kong, Hungary, India, Ireland, Malawi, Mexico, The Netherlands, Paraguay, Poland, Scotland, South Africa, Tanzania, Thailand, Trinidad & Tobago, Uganda, USA and Wales.

In Victoria the Promoters will enter an international competition presenting their project or program to the hockey world. The creator of the most outstanding contribution will earn the title WorldHockey Promoter 2008.

The Festival will be hosted by the University of Victoria and is organized by the FIH in close cooperation with Field Hockey Canada. Participants will stay with host families and will come to the university each day to learn about coaching, umpiring, event management, communication and administration. Daily Festival reports will be published on the FIH website and the special WorldHockey Olympic Qualifier website.

Previous World Youth Hockey Promoters Festivals were held in Hobart 2001, Amstelveen 2003 and Santiago de Chile 2005.
